World No. 2 Kent Farrington (USA) leads a star-studded field into Traverse City, MI, on 20 September for the opening leg of the Longines FEI Jumping World Cup™ North American League (NAL) 2026/2027.
Coming off his inaugural World Cup™ Final victory in Fort Worth last April and a recent CSI5* Grand Prix win at the Hampton Classic with the brilliant 12-year-old mare Greya, Farrington targets a third consecutive Traverse City season-opener win.
Star-Studded Opening Field
Traverse City marks the first of seven NAL legs across the USA, Canada, and Mexico, offering crucial points toward the 2027 Final in Gothenburg (SWE). Joining Farrington in the line-up are four fellow top-20 world-ranked riders:

Shane Sweetnam (IRL) – World No. 5, fresh off a CSI5* Kubota Grand Prix win at Angelstone.

McLain Ward (USA) – 2017 World Cup™ Champion.

Daniel Bluman (ISR) – Reached a career-high world ranking of No. 6 in August.

Christian Kukuk (GER) – Paris 2024 Olympic Individual Champion.

Roberto Teran Tafur (COL) – Fresh off an impressive 5th-place individual finish at the 2026 FEI World Championship in Aachen with the 18-year-old stallion Dez’ Ooktoff.
The Road to Gothenburg
At season’s end, the NAL will award 14 qualification spots for the Gothenburg Final (7 US East, 3 US West, 2 Canada, 2 Mexico), based on an athlete's top four performances.
